数据库技术上什么课

worktile 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在学习数据库技术方面,有许多不同的课程可以选择。以下是一些常见的数据库技术课程:

    1. 数据库管理系统:这门课程通常是数据库技术的入门课程,介绍数据库的基本概念、原理和技术。学生将学习如何设计、创建和管理数据库,以及如何使用SQL语言进行数据查询和操作。

    2. 数据库设计与建模:这门课程侧重于数据库的设计和建模。学生将学习如何根据实际需求设计数据库的结构和关系,以及如何使用建模工具进行数据库建模。

    3. 数据库编程:这门课程教授学生如何使用编程语言与数据库进行交互。学生将学习如何使用编程语言(如Java、Python等)编写程序来连接数据库、执行查询和更新操作。

    4. 数据仓库与商业智能:这门课程介绍数据仓库和商业智能的概念和技术。学生将学习如何设计和构建数据仓库,以及如何使用商业智能工具来进行数据分析和决策支持。

    5. 数据库安全与隐私:这门课程讲解数据库安全和隐私保护的原理和方法。学生将学习如何设计和实施安全的数据库访问控制机制,以及如何保护敏感数据的隐私。

    除了上述课程外,还有其他一些高级数据库技术课程可供选择,如分布式数据库、并行数据库、NoSQL数据库等。选择适合自己的课程,根据自己的兴趣和职业规划,有助于深入学习和掌握数据库技术。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库技术领域,有许多课程可以帮助你学习和掌握相关的知识和技能。以下是一些常见的数据库技术课程:

    1. 数据库管理系统:这门课程通常是数据库技术的入门课程,介绍数据库的基本概念、原理和设计方法。它涵盖了数据库模型、关系代数、SQL查询语言和数据库管理系统的实现原理。

    2. 数据库设计:这门课程专注于数据库的设计和规划。学生将学习如何识别和建模实体、属性和关系,并设计适合特定应用需求的数据库结构。此外,还会介绍数据库设计中的规范化和性能优化技术。

    3. 数据库编程:这门课程教授数据库编程技术,使学生能够使用编程语言与数据库进行交互。学生将学习如何使用SQL语言进行数据查询、插入、更新和删除操作,并了解如何使用存储过程、触发器和视图等高级技术。

    4. 数据仓库和数据挖掘:这门课程介绍了数据仓库和数据挖掘的基本概念和技术。学生将学习如何设计和实现数据仓库,以及如何使用数据挖掘技术从大量数据中发现有用的模式和关联。

    5. 分布式数据库:这门课程探讨了分布式数据库系统的设计和管理。学生将学习如何处理分布式数据库中的数据复制、一致性和故障恢复等问题,以及如何优化分布式查询和事务处理性能。

    6. NoSQL数据库:这门课程介绍了NoSQL数据库的原理和应用。学生将学习不同类型的NoSQL数据库,如键值存储、文档存储和列存储,以及如何选择和使用适合特定应用场景的NoSQL数据库。

    7. 数据库安全和隐私:这门课程涵盖了数据库安全和隐私保护的相关知识。学生将学习如何设计和实施数据库的访问控制、身份验证和加密等安全措施,以及如何处理敏感数据和隐私保护的问题。

    8. 数据库性能优化:这门课程教授数据库性能优化的技术和方法。学生将学习如何分析和调优查询计划、索引设计、缓存策略和数据库配置,以提高数据库系统的性能和响应速度。

    除了以上列出的课程,还有许多其他专门的数据库技术课程,如大数据管理、数据可视化、数据库应用开发等。选择适合自己需求和兴趣的课程,可以帮助你在数据库技术领域取得更深入的理解和专业知识。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库技术是计算机科学与技术专业中的一门重要课程。在数据库技术课程中,学生将学习数据库的基本概念、原理、设计和应用技术。该课程通常涵盖以下内容:

    1. 数据库基础知识:介绍数据库的基本概念、特点和分类,包括数据模型、数据结构、数据管理和数据操作等基础知识。

    2. 关系数据库理论:介绍关系模型的基本理论,包括关系代数、关系演算和关系完整性等概念。

    3. SQL语言:介绍SQL语言的基本语法、查询、更新和事务处理等操作,学习如何使用SQL语言与数据库进行交互。

    4. 数据库设计与规范化:介绍数据库设计的基本原则和方法,包括实体-关系模型、关系模式设计、关系数据库设计和数据库规范化等内容。

    5. 数据库索引与性能优化:介绍数据库索引的原理和使用方法,以及如何通过索引和性能优化技术提高数据库的查询效率和数据访问性能。

    6. 数据库安全与备份恢复:介绍数据库安全性的基本概念和技术,包括用户权限管理、数据加密、安全审计和备份恢复等内容。

    7. 分布式数据库与数据仓库:介绍分布式数据库和数据仓库的基本概念和架构,学习如何设计和管理分布式数据库和数据仓库系统。

    8. NoSQL和大数据处理:介绍NoSQL数据库的基本概念和特点,以及大数据处理的基本原理和技术,学习如何使用NoSQL数据库和大数据处理工具进行数据管理和分析。

    在数据库技术课程中,通常会结合理论与实践相结合的教学方法,学生需要通过实验和项目来巩固所学知识,并能够独立设计和管理数据库系统。通过学习数据库技术,学生能够掌握数据库的基本原理和技术,具备设计、管理和优化数据库系统的能力,为企业和组织的数据管理和应用提供支持。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部